Naira up to N1,430/$ in parallel market

By Elizabeth Adegbesan
The naira yesterday appreciated to N1,430 per dollar in the parallel market from N1,470 per dollar last weekend.
Similarly, the naira yesterday appreciated to N1,408. 04 per dollar in the Nigerian Foreign Exchange Market (NAFEM).
Data from FMDQ showed that the indicative exchange rate for NAFEM fell to N1,408.04 per dollar from N1,431.49 per dollar last week Friday, indicating N23.45 appreciation for the naira.
Consequently, the margin between the parallel market rate and NAFEM narrowed to N21.96 per dollar from N38.51 per dollar last week Friday.
